The battle against teen vaping
from Rawlco Radio Ltd. · host Rawlco Radio Ltd.
Ontario schools are installing vape detectors in washrooms in an effort to curb teen vaping and make students feel safer at school. But while the technology may help catch students in the act, it also raises a bigger question: why are so many young people vaping in the first place, and what can parents, schools, and policymakers do about it? Tamara speaks with Rob Cunningham, Senior Policy Analyst with the Canadian Cancer Society.
